Every Shabbat day 50-70 guests come together at the home of Louis Kemp in David’s Village, right next to Mamilla in Jerusalem. Every age, color, nationality and religious level, and some married couples, however, Louis specializes in singles coming together. Before he made aliyah a couple of years ago, at his home in Pacific Palisades he would host 500 person singles events. Since I have been the hostess with the mostess at our Shabbat Lunch extraordinaire, I have personally seen numerous couples meet and start dating, and just recently three engagements!

There is a group of volunteers that gather every Wednesday to cook fresh and delicious food, curated by Daryl Temkin. He is the heart of the operation and creates the menus, buys the fresh ingredients, and guides all of us to make plenty and tasty treats every week for the ultimate Shabbat experience. Daryl leads us with beautiful words from the Torah portion of the week and sings the Kiddush blessing on the wine, and Louis makes the blessings on washing our hands and Hamotzie Lechem Min Haaretz, as the room quietly waits to say Amen and take their first bite of Challah bread.
